publish-scripts/ubuntu/buildDEB.py (71 lines of code) (raw):

#! /usr/bin/env python3 import os import wget import zipfile import shutil import datetime from string import Template from shared import constants from shared import helper # version used in url is provided from user input # version used for packaging .deb package needs a slight modification # for beta, change to tilde, so it will be placed before rtm versions in apt # https://unix.stackexchange.com/questions/230911/what-is-the-meaning-of-the-tilde-in-some-debian-openjdk-package-version-string/230921 def returnDebVersion(version): """ Convert user-provided version into Debian package format. Uses tilde (~) to ensure beta versions are correctly sorted before RTM versions. """ strlist = version.split('-') if len(strlist) == 1: return strlist[0]+"-1" elif len(strlist) == 2: return f"{strlist[0]}~{strlist[1]}-1" else: raise NotImplementedError # depends on gzip, dpkg-deb, strip @helper.restoreDirectory def preparePackage(): """ Prepares and builds a Debian package. This includes setting up directories, copying necessary files, generating SHA256 hashes, and building the final .deb package. """ os.chdir(constants.DRIVERROOTDIR) debianVersion = returnDebVersion(constants.VERSION) packageFolder = f"{constants.PACKAGENAME}_{debianVersion}" buildFolder = os.path.join(os.getcwd(), constants.BUILDFOLDER, packageFolder) helper.linuxOutput(buildFolder) os.chdir(buildFolder) document = os.path.join("usr", "share", "doc", constants.PACKAGENAME) os.makedirs(document) # Copy MIT copyright file print("include MIT copyright") scriptDir = os.path.abspath(os.path.dirname(__file__)) shutil.copyfile(os.path.join(scriptDir, "copyright"), os.path.join(document, "copyright")) # Generate changelog file from template with open(os.path.join(scriptDir, "changelog_template")) as f: stringData = f.read() # read until EOF t = Template(stringData) # datetime example: Tue, 06 April 2018 16:32:31 time = datetime.datetime.utcnow().strftime("%a, %d %b %Y %X") with open(os.path.join(document, "changelog.Debian"), "w") as f: print(f"writing changelog with date utc: {time}") f.write(t.safe_substitute(DEBIANVERSION=debianVersion, DATETIME=time, VERSION=constants.VERSION, PACKAGENAME=constants.PACKAGENAME)) # Compress changelog using gzip (by default gzip compress file in place) helper.printReturnOutput(["gzip", "-9", "-n", os.path.join(document, "changelog.Debian")]) helper.chmodFolderAndFiles(os.path.join("usr", "share")) debian = "DEBIAN" os.makedirs(debian) # Generate SHA256 hashes for all files in 'usr/' print("trying to produce sha256 hashes") with open('DEBIAN/sha256sums', 'w') as sha256file: # iterate over all files under 'usr/' & get their sha256sum for dirpath, _, filenames in os.walk('usr'): for f in filenames: filepath = os.path.join(dirpath, f) if not os.path.islink(filepath): h = helper.produceHashForfile(filepath, 'sha256', Upper=False) sha256file.write(f"{h} {filepath}\n") # Generate the control file with package dependencies from template deps = [] for key, value in constants.LINUXDEPS.items(): entry = f"{key} ({value})" deps.append(entry) deps = ','.join(deps) with open(os.path.join(scriptDir, "control_template")) as f: stringData = f.read() t = Template(stringData) with open(os.path.join(debian, "control"), "w") as f: print("trying to write control file") f.write(t.safe_substitute(DEBIANVERSION=debianVersion, PACKAGENAME=constants.PACKAGENAME, DEPENDENCY=deps)) helper.chmodFolderAndFiles(debian) # Generate post-install script postinst = '' with open(os.path.join(scriptDir, "postinst_template")) as f: postinst = f.read() with open(os.path.join(debian, "postinst"), "w") as f: print("trying to write postinst file") f.write(postinst) # Ensure post-install script has correct permissions # postinstall has to be 0755 in order for it to work. os.chmod(os.path.join(debian, "postinst"), 0o755) # Build the Debian package using dpkg-deb os.chdir(constants.DRIVERROOTDIR) output = helper.printReturnOutput(["fakeroot", "dpkg-deb", "--build", "-Zxz", os.path.join(constants.BUILDFOLDER, packageFolder), os.path.join(constants.ARTIFACTFOLDER, packageFolder+".deb")]) assert(f"building package '{constants.PACKAGENAME}'" in output)
